Safety and Fire Declaration Forms

The City requires all mobile food vendors to submit declaration forms.  If an item is Not Applicable, the inspector is required to mark off the N/A option and sign off on this as the City does not inspect vendor units.  Incomplete declaration forms will not be accepted. Forms are subject to audit. All relevant declaration forms expire yearly.

Special Events and Festivals 

For event organizers that would like to obtain a special event or festival vendor permit, please fill in your online application

Applications for special events and festivals must be submitted a minimum of 7 business days in advance of the event start date. A list of vendors in PDF format is required. Please note that only approved vendors will be permitted under the event or festival vending permit.

Please be advised that a response can take up to 10 business days.
